Am Montag, 5. Januar 2009 21:09:41 schrieb chip:
There must be an override to make the shortInstrumentName not
appear on the individual parts?
Just don't set it in the individual parts ;-)
So I have to put them in the /score /book section I am guessing. I have
this section -
\book { \score {
<< \new Staff = "trumpet" \trumpet
\new Staff = "trumpetb" \trumpetb
\new Staff = "alto" \altosax
\new Staff = "altob" \altosaxb
\new Staff = "tenor" \tenorsax
\new Staff = "bari" \barisax
\new Staff = "trombone" \trombone
\new Staff = "tromboneb" \tromboneb
>> } }
Is this where I would set the short instrument name? I'm not sure how
I would do that here.
Regards,
Chip
Or, alternatively, you can also remove the Instrument_name_engraver from the
appropriate contexts (Staff?)
